Other Objective Questions
Indicate by a PRP if the characteristic applies to a sole proprietorship, an SC if it applies to an S corporation, and a PAR if it applies to a partnership, and N if it does not apply to any of the three businesses. A characteristic can apply to more than one entity; write a brief explanation if a characteristic may only apply under certain conditions.
-Owner may deduct losses if there is basis because of loans to the entity by the owner.


Definitions:

Marginal Cost

An additional cost incurred by producing one more unit of a product or service, a key concept in economics for decision-making.

Inverse Demand Curve

A graphical representation showing the relationship between the price of a good and the quantity demanded when price is the independent variable.

Cournot Duopolists

Firms in a duopoly market structure (two firms) where each firm determines its production level assuming the other firm's production level is fixed, as in the Cournot competition model.
